VidSynth 1.02S This synth takes advantage of Usine's feature set to interpret input video into live wavetable for it's oscillators.
That translates to 3 oscillators per voice (Red Green and Blue or Hue Saturation and Lightness) which can be turned off individually to reduce CPU usage or make less complex sound. Red/Hue oscillator additionally have detune control (which also plays role in spread control) and is cross-mixed with Green/Saturation oscilator for panoramic effect (stereOSC control). Blue oscillator doesn't have special features, can be used as sub-osc.
There's TV section where you either load video or image directly to the list or use input from elswhere (which will save some CPU). Then by selecting a point on the screen you get cross section for Vertical and Horizontal arrays of data, which can be mixed by V-H control and then further mixed between either RGB or HSL colour data interpretation.
Additionally to resulting wave, you can set 'pulsewidth' which will wrap the wave around with optional inversion and flip. Then there's also shaper tools with Shape and Amt controls to add classical shapes to resulting wavetables for more predictable and familiar sound. Also there's speed slider for wavetable change rate to smooth transformations of resulting waves.
Another factor that will affect both video and sound is two effect sliders in TV section - smooth and noise-blur. Smooth is kind of motion blur effect which will result in smear for video and smoother changes to wavetable. Noise-Blur is a combination of two effects, Noise is increased towards the middle section and then classic blur takes effect for second half of the slider, which results in rounder waves.
Notice in TV screen there's Green and Blue dots flying around, those are particles revolving around point of selection and there are settings for their behaviour. You can apply their motions to various controls via Modulation matrix along with other sources and destinations.
This synth can utilise from reasonable to high CPU% depending on settings, main factors are Max resolution slider (found at the bottom-left) and Max voices setting in popup panel (click settings wheel in header). Then you can also turn volume of each oscillator down to 0 to turn it off and use external video input as mentioned earlier.

When that is sorted out, here's how it works: This synth have 3 wavetable oscillators and they receive real-time generated arrays as wavetables. Arrays are generated from scanning input image or video by X and Y axis. Since image can be described as arrays of RGB or HSL values, there's fader to mix between these interpretations, then there's V-H mix for vertical and horizontal slices of images (which again produce different arrays), additionally the slices coordinates are spread between OSC's when 'spread' fader is applied (along with delaying phases for stereo effect).
Finally resulting arrays go through optional transformations: PWM parameter shifts the arrays, affected amount can be set for each OSC, along with optional flipping and mirroring of the shifted array.
Then in the Wavetable display you see Shape and Amt controls that can mix in classic oscillator shapes (when Amt is at the bottom no shaping is applied), and finally there's wavetable transition smoothing parameter (WT change speed) with separate PWM switch so it can be unaffected. That about covers specific of wave forming in this synth, mod matrix is pretty self-explanatory.
Since mod matrix can affect some parameters that have their own faders, those faders work centered values with visual indication of range of modulation applied and actual value floating in it. R and S buttons near LFO button are Retrigger and Sync. Unison is basically Chorus effect applied to OSC's independently, which can produce massive sound and I found it to be 'cheapest' way to achieve.

Most notable change is that I replaced oli_lab's Ladder Filter with Simple Filter for various reasons, it seems to run smoother that way and easier to get familiar sound. Hope to add FM modulations later.
Here's changelog: * Fixed incorrect scaling for Filter frequency destination in Modulation Matrix (selectable through Joker combo-box) * Fixed potential bad behaviour of Filter when using inverted envelope * Fixed clicks on fast attack * Fixed edit access for list of added videos/images. * Added pitchbend and modwheel support. To use modwheel, type 'modwheel' in desired control's binding. * Replaced Ladder Filter from oli_lab with stock Simple filter to balance performance and ease of use. * Replaced Spray effect with Noise effect in video effects sliders. * Two Mod destinations previously reserved for Ladder Filter FM parameters are replaced with Shaper width and shape modulations. * Rearranged UI for new features * V-H, RGB-HSL, PWM, LFO freq and Detune are now modulated relatively to their value with visual feedback. * Added PWM amount for each oscillator for differentiation, also added flip switch and inversion for each OSC individually. * Added PW switch for Wavetable speed smoother. If turned on, slider smooths overall wavetable (as it did before), but with PW off Shaper and PWM modulations are unaffected. * Added unison slider * Added option to loop video for synced period using scan position as start of the loop. See popup-window settings. * Changed output OScilloscope from 3 osc's view to overall stereo sum after filter, but before envelopes for more comprehensive visual feedback. * Added scan index splitting for spread slider.
